Thousands of academics sign letter opposing Trump's travel ban


By late Saturday afternoon, more than 4,000 academics, including more than two dozen Nobel laureates, signed an open letter going around the academic community addressed to Trump. The unethical and discriminatory treatment of law-abiding, hard-working and well-integrated immigrants fundamentally contravenes the founding principles of the United States," the letter reads. Asked about the travel ban at the White House Saturday afternoon, Trump rejected a description of the order as a "Muslim ban" and said it was "working out very nicely."
